1. Do you plan to compete again? Do you see yourself competing into the later phases of your life, or will competition merely be a fixture of your youth, something you look back upon?

I don't think I will be competing this year - thats not set in stone, but most likely I will not.  I'm in the tail end of my PhD and really need to focus 100% on that.  I put  my heart and soul into competing and other things in my life start to suffer so I really can't afford to have that right now.[/quote]

Maybe in the future yes I would definitely be interested in competing again.  I haven't closed that door, but I'm not rushing to jump back on stage , whenever it happens it happens, if not thats all good too.  Bodybuilding for me was never about competing, it was about me just getting bigger and stronger, competition was just something I did in parallel to that whenever I got the itch.

2. I recall you mentioning that you're in a graduate program of one sort or another. Does the dieting ever interfere with your studies in a notable (detrimental) way? How do you balance the cognitive demands of (presumably) intensive study with the often disruptive effects on mental function dieting brings?

When I was in undergrad studying Systems Engineering I competed two years, my grades didn't suffer - but it did definitely interfere with my productivity especially around 4-6 weeks out, I was like a fucking zombie in class, really having a hard time focusing, sometimes I skipped class all together, and didn't want to do anything at all.  My social life also suffered a lot too.

So now doing my PhD, I'm not taking classes, but I'm conducting research and just want to get through with it as smoothly as possible which is why I don't want to worry myself with the stresses of dieting for a show, sure I'm gonna diet now, but if ever I find that its interfering with any of my work I'm just gonna say fuck it and lax a bit - but I don't really see that happening.  I mean you see the starting point, its not like this diet is that severe or anything!

3. Why don't you go to the darkside? Is it ethical concerns or just practical ones?

I have no interest in breaking the law or doing anything illegal.  I have a wife, a career, and want to start a family and all that.  Don't want anything to interfere or ruin that.

Thats not to say that I would not consider taking any legal over the counter pro-hormones, I would do that and would be very open about it (as I have been in the past) its just that there is nothing good in the market right now, and what was there is now banned.

Alright.... as I said a few weeks ago.  I'm gonna start leaning out some when the new year starts.  And this is exactly what is going to happen. 

I haven't really dieted down much when I'm not competing, but since I haven't competed in a few years, I think its about time.  I don't really have a set weight in mind, nor do I have a set time period for this dieting (which I guess is bad on both counts) I just want to get my love handles in check and my guess is that its gonna take 25-30 lbs for that to happen. 

This morning I weighed 236 lbs - which is fine... I've been on vacation eating like a fucking a pig and haven't worked out for 2 weeks, I needed some time off as I've been having some bad elbow pain from some heavy tricep work outs as well as a few other dings here and there.  But tomorrow I'm gonna get back into the swing of things.  I haven't measured my body fat yet but my guess is that its around 22-23%

I'm not so much worried about staying on my diet (although, I have yet to ever diet and not cheat at least once - but either way its never been catastrophic lol, I know what it takes for my body to get in shape - I've done it so many times in the past).  I'm more worried about losing muscle mass and not looking "big"  Thats always been the main reason of why I avoid dieting down, I just start to feel small, light, and puny!  So I guess I'm gonna try to lose weight slowly and steadily, in order to maintain or maybe even gain some muscle.

Believe it or not, I actually keep a rough estimate of my caloric intake in the off-season and its normally between 3500 - 4000 calories.  (obviously not counting Sundays when I order pizza and watch my Redskins kick ass).

But to get my butt in gear, I'm gonna start this diet at 2800 calories  (In the past when I competed, I would start my diet with 2500 calories but when I did that I was usually in a time crunch to be ready for a show, this time as I don't really have a set deadline, I'm gonna start a little higher and work my way down).  A few weeks in I may add in a fat burning supplements and possibly some test boosters (OTC  :P  )

Below are the foods I'll be eating day in and day out.  As the weeks go by, and depending on how my weight loss goes I will start to cut out some calories, usually 200-300 calories at a time, and usually I cut these calories out from carb sources.

I do cardio right after my work out, which is usually in the evening and lasts about 2 hours.  The cardio will be 15-20 minutes of high intensity on the elliptical (using progressive resistance where I increase the resistance every minute and maintain or increase speed), I'll start with 3 times a week minimum (but usually I'll do more) and increase every few weeks.  On the weekends I may go out for a job or a walk around the neighborhood nothing too vicious.

I'll get some pictures up soon (until then, you guys can enjoy my duck face below), and I'll try to keep this thread pretty up to date every couples of weeks or so, discussing my progress, and sharing how things are going, whether I cheated or not and on what, etc.

So this is what I'll be eating, its kinda unorthodox but it works for me:

Meal 1   
5 Whole eggs
1 scoop syntrax (Protein shake)
1 scoop syntrax
Glucosamine
Multivitamins
   
Meal 2   
1 footlong Grilled Chicken sub with wheat bread
   
Meal 3   
1 footlong Grilled Chicken sub with wheat bread
   
Intra-WO   
4 Tea-Spoons CORE ABC (BCAA's)
5 g creatine
   
Meal 4
(PWO)   
1 scoop syntrax
1 scoop syntrax
1 bottle of gatorade performs (20 oz)
5 g creatine
   
Meal 5   
1 Chicken breast
1 bag Uncle Ben's Ready Rice

251 g protein, 310 g carbs, 61 g fat.  2800 Calories Total.
